Web5. Although the rotation is a fairly simple one, it still contains nine plant species. Rotation #2. Year 1: Buckwheat, rye cover crop. Year 2: Soybeans overseeded with spelt or winter wheat. Year 3: Spelt, oil radish. Year 4: Oats underseeded with red clover. Year 5: Red Clover harvested for hay or seed, winter wheat. Web♦ Rotation: Une rotation des cultures avec une plante non-graminée est importante pour lutter contre l’ergot et la fusariose de l’épi. Pour cette dernière maladie, le maïs est à proscrire car cette espèce végétale est sensible à la fusariose et constitue donc un excellent réservoir pour la conservation du champignon.

WebCrop rotation is the practice of growing a series of different types of crops in the same area across a sequence of growing seasons. It reduces reliance on one set of nutrients, pest and weed pressure, and the probability of developing resistant pests and weeds.
